The Importance of Concrete Surface Preparation

Preparing concrete surfaces for coatings, overlays, stains, or repair materials is a labor-intensive task that many contractors are tempted to overlook. However, skipping this essential first step almost guarantees project failure. Whether you are working on a residential patio or an industrial warehouse, proper surface preparation is the foundation of a long-lasting finish.

Why Prepare Concrete Surfaces?

Concrete preparation is required whenever you are resurfacing old slabs to look like new or upgrading to a high-end decorative concrete finish.

Today’s advanced polymer-modified overlays offer incredible versatility:

  • Thin-set applications: Applied as thin as 1/8″.

  • Stamped overlays: Applied up to 3/4″ thick and stamped to mimic natural stone or wood.

  • Industrial utility: Essential for floor-coating installations in commercial and institutional settings.

Achieving the Right Concrete Surface Profile (CSP)

The most critical factor for the bond strength of resurfacing materials or epoxy floor coatings is the texture of the concrete. Without the correct profile, the overlay cannot “grip” the substrate, leading to delamination and cracking.
